Have GtkWidget implement GtkAccessible
authorEmmanuele Bassi <ebassi@gnome.org>
Wed, 8 Jul 2020 15:58:11 +0000 (16:58 +0100)
committerEmmanuele Bassi <ebassi@gnome.org>
Sun, 26 Jul 2020 19:31:14 +0000 (20:31 +0100)
commit25f6da5e897a113a781d5575723afa4d56cddd88
tree94f9d5d2f30f1d326b3224ad7f557b8976e5c19e
parent566f75af824d77a968fb8a835a7ab8d4f3331bf6
Have GtkWidget implement GtkAccessible

Each widget type has an accessible role associated to its class, as
roles cannot change during the life time of a widget instance.

Each widget is also responsible for creating an ATContext, to proxy
state changes to the underlying accessibility infrastructure.
gtk/gtkwidget.c
gtk/gtkwidget.h
gtk/gtkwidgetprivate.h